How does citrate synthase prevent side reactions, stored accumulation. Oxaloacetate+acetyl coa +h2o citryl coa (thio bond) citrate +coa + h+ Ccatalyzes synthethic reaction , 2 units joined without direct use of atp. 49 kd, oxaloacetate binds first (conformational change) and then acetyl. Cannot hydrolyze acetyl coa but can to cirate coa also hydrolysis not in place until citrate coa formed, stored in vacuoles n fruits (0. 3m) accumulation thru mito. Toxin, activated to fluoroacetyl coa, reacts with citrate to become suicide inhibitor of aconitase, shuts down citrate acid cycle, therefore pesticide, Nad and fad come from reduction of o2. Competitive inhibitor for succinate dehydrogenase, competes with succinate. Succinate dehydrogenase has 4 nuclearly encoded subunits, sdha mutation causes e, other 3 cause tumor formation, create superoxide radical.
